The benefits of investing in a swimming pool cover are:
- Increase water efficiency – pool covers reduce excess heat and contain moisture which avoids water evaporation by up to 95% resulting in savings on your water bill
- Increase water cleanliness – pool covers limit the amount of leaves, debris and bugs landing in your water which also reduces the likelihood of algae growth
- Maintain water temperature – when the outdoor temperature drops overnight, the pool water temperature will also drop. A pool cover helps to keep the heat in which can save you on heating and electricity costs.
- Reduce chemical usage – By limiting the amount of debris and algae in the water, your pool will stay cleaner for longer which can cut down on the amount of chemicals needed to keep the pool clean
- Reduce time spent on maintenance – All of the above benefits means you will be spending less time refilling, heating and cleaning the water which gives you more time to relax and enjoy your pool
Pool covers come in a range of different materials, shapes, sizes and ease of use which include:
STANDARD WINTER COVER
A standard winter cover is the cheapest option on the market and is made from a tarp-like material. This option will keep out sunlight and debris however this material is not very attractive or durable and will need to be replaced at least once a year. The cover holds very little weight which means it cannot be walked on and can be dangerous for children and animals. This option also requires a pump to avoid the cover from caving in due to a build up of water on top.
SECURITY POOL COVER
Security covers are the most popular option and look similar to a trampoline. They are made from two different materials:
- Mesh – While this material is very durable (lasting between 10-15 years), supports a great amount of weight and keeps debris out, rain water does pass through into the pool. This means there is no need for a pump, however this can dirty the water resulting in extra cleaning effort when you’re ready to use the pool again.
- Solid Vinyl – This material will last between 6-10 years and will not let any debris or water pass through so your water will stay clean. However, because the water does not pass through, you will need a pump on top which will need replacing every 2-4 years.
AUTOMATIC POOL COVERS
Automatic covers are the most expensive option as they are fantastic solar covers and give you constant protection against debris and dirty rain water. In fact, they can be so effective that they can heat the water a little too warm. So much so that it feels more like taking a bath than having a refreshing dip in the pool. This option is also less durable as the material will need replacing every five years, and the many mechanical components may require repairs from time to time.
